Tripoli's Triggers Firearms Training & Educational Center

531 Washington Blvd.

www.tripolistriggers.com

Beginners Firearms Safety Course: Participants will learn how to safely load and unload a firearm, safe clearing procedures, basic pistol shooting skills, and more. One-day classes will be held 5-8 p.m. Nov. 15, 6-9 p.m. Nov. 19 and 9 a.m.-noon Nov. 24. The price has changed; contact the range for information.

Hogan's Alley Shoot: 5 p.m. Nov. 20. This decision-making course is used by the FBI. Targets demonstrate "good guy/bad guy" scenarios. Range lights are off and the targets are set on edge until the range officer turns on spotlights when it is time to engage a target. The target is turned to face the shooter, who must make a quick decision whether to fire.
